I was about to package netxmms (aka xmms-net) when I noticed that in the 
three months since I took the ITP, upstream has vanished.  I can't even 
download the source.  The latter point makes it especially likely that 
this package isn't going into Debian.

For the record, http://freshmeat.net/projects/netxmms/ has 
http://freshmeat.net/redir/netxmms/53299/url_homepage/netxmms as project 
homepage.  Google is no help either.
